Definition

Let $\mathbf A = \sqbrk a_{m n}$ be a matrix.

The superdiagonals of $A$ are the diagonals of $\mathbf A$ lying parallel to and above the main diagonal of $\mathbf A$.

That is, the elements $\map a {r + k, s + k}$ where $s > r$.
